Enabling Trap Messages Conforming to 802.1d Standard
When enabled, the switch sends the following two types of 802.1d-compliant traps to the network
management device:
z When the switch is configured to be the root bridge of a spanning tree instance, it sends
802.1d-compliant newroot traps to the network management device.
z When the switch detects a topology change, it sends 802.1d-compliant topology-change traps to
the network management device.
The stp instance instance-id dot1d-trap enable command enables both newroot and topology-change
trap functions for the specified spanning tree instance at the same time.
Configuration procedure
Follow these steps to enable trap messages conforming to 802.1d standard:
To do... Use the command... Remarks
Enter system view
system-view
Enable trap messages conforming
to 802.1d standard in an instance
stp [ instance instance-id ] dot1d-trap
[ newroot | topologychange ] enable
Required
Configuration example
# Enable a switch to send trap messages conforming to 802.1d standard to the network management
device when the switch becomes the root bridge of instance 1.
<Sysname> system-view
[Sysname] stp instance 1 dot1d-trap newroot enable
Displaying and Maintaining MSTP
To do... Use the command... Remarks
Display the state and statistics
information about spanning trees of
the current device
display stp [ instance instance-id ]
[ interface interface-list | slot
slot-number ] [ brief ]
Display region configuration
display stp region-configuration
Display information about the ports
that are shut down by STP
protection
display stp portdown
Display information about the ports
that are blocked by STP protection
display stp abnormalport
Display information about the root
port of the instance where the switch
reside
display stp root
Available in any view
Clear statistics about MSTP reset stp [ interface interface-list ] Available in user view
